Flexible Financing for Self-Employed Borrowers

Traditional mortgage applications often rely heavily on tax returns and W-2 forms to verify income. But for entrepreneurs, freelancers, business owners, and independent contractors, tax documents don’t always tell the full story.

A bank statement mortgage loan offers an alternative path to homeownership by allowing lenders to evaluate your income using your personal or business bank statements instead of traditional employment documents.

What Is a Bank Statement Mortgage Loan?

A bank statement mortgage loan is a mortgage option created for borrowers whose income may be difficult to verify through conventional methods.

Instead of using tax returns, lenders review your bank statements—typically from the last 12 to 24 months—to assess your cash flow and determine your ability to repay the loan.

This type of loan can be an excellent option for:

  • Small business owners
  • Entrepreneurs
  • Freelancers
  • Consultants
  • Independent contractors
  • Gig workers
  • Real estate investors
  • Commission-based professionals

How It Works

The process is straightforward:

  1. Provide 12–24 months of personal or business bank statements.
  2. Lenders analyze your deposits and cash flow.
  3. Your qualifying income is calculated.
  4. Loan options are matched to your financial profile.
  5. You move forward with the mortgage application process.

Who Should Consider This Loan?

A bank statement mortgage may be right for you if:

  • You are self-employed.
  • Your tax deductions reduce your reported income.
  • You own a business.
  • You earn income from multiple sources.
  • You have strong cash flow but don’t meet traditional lending requirements.

Common Requirements

While requirements vary by lender, borrowers typically need:

  • Twelve to twenty-four months of bank statements
  • Good credit history
  • A stable source of income
  • A down payment or sufficient equity
  • Proof of business ownership (if applicable)
